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
PHP 5/6. В подлиннике. Авторы: Кузнецов М.В., Симдянов И.В. Самоучитель PHP 5 / 6 (3 издание). Авторы: Кузнецов М.В., Симдянов И.В. PHP 5. На примерах. Авторы: Кузнецов М.В., Симдянов И.В., Голышев С.В. Объектно-ориентированное программирование на PHP. Авторы: Кузнецов М.В., Симдянов И.В. C++. Мастер-класс в задачах и примерах.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

Форум MySQL

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ум (новые сообщения вниз) Структурный форум

тема: добавление полей в базу MySql

Сообщения:  [1-5] 

 
 автор: Lisjann   (28.07.2009 в 12:46)   письмо автору
 
   для: а-я   (24.07.2009 в 12:48)
 

if (isset($_POST['Proect']))
  {

  $sql="INSERT into Proect (Proect) VALUES ({$_POST['Proect']})";

  $insProj=mysql_query($sql) or die (mysql_error());
  }
if (isset($_POST['Podr']))
  {
  $indPodr1=substr($_POST['Podr'],0,1);
  $sql1="INSERT into Proect (indNP) VALUES ({$indPodr1})";
  $insProj1=mysql_query($sql) or die (mysql_error());


я делаю так и у меня вылазиет ошибка токого рода
"Duplicate entry '0' for key 1"

  Ответить  
 
 автор: а-я   (24.07.2009 в 12:48)   письмо автору
 
   для: Trianon   (24.07.2009 в 12:31)
 

=) да, но на таком уровни, хотя бы помочь чтоб все заработало...

  Ответить  
 
 автор: Trianon   (24.07.2009 в 12:31)   письмо автору
 
   для: а-я   (24.07.2009 в 12:18)
 

и SQL-injection во всей красе.

  Ответить  
 
 автор: а-я   (24.07.2009 в 12:18)   письмо автору
 
   для: Lisjann   (24.07.2009 в 12:12)
 


<?
$sql 
'
INSERT INTO 
`Proect` 
(`Proect`, `tabNP`)
VALUES ("'
.$_POST['Proect'].'", "'.$_POST['indProect'].'");
'
;

$insProj mysql_query($sql) or die(mysql_error());
?>

  Ответить  
 
 автор: Lisjann   (24.07.2009 в 12:12)   письмо автору
 
 

$insProj=mysql_query
('INSERT into Proect, (Proect, tabNP)
VALUES (\''.$_POST['Proect'].'\',\''$_POST['indProect']..'\')');
я использую такой код для вставки в базу, данные находятся на другой форме в текстовом поле и списке выбора
<input type=text name=Proect>
и
$result = mysql_query("SELECT indProect FROM Proect)
echo '<td> <select name="Podr">';
while ($rowPod = mysql_fetch_array($result))
{
echo '<option value="'.$rowPro[indProect].'">"'.$rowPro[indProect].
}
отпровляю данные кнопкой -
echo'<input type="submit" value="Отослать форму">';
. Записи в поля таблиц БД почему то не добовляются

  Ответить  

Сообщения:  [1-5] 

Форум разработан IT-студией SoftTime
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ования